Dead Coin Battery

If the Bentley Flying Spur remote control isn't locking the doors or unlocking them it could be due to the coin battery has died. It is easy to replace the battery however, you should use a new one that has the same voltage, size and specifications. The wrong batteries could cause damage to the key fob.

It also helps to check the clips of metal that hold the key fob for tension. If the clip is damaged or loose, it could cause problems. damaged, it may cause contact issues and a lack of power transfer to the remote control. Worn Buttons

The buttons made of rubber on the Bentley key fob are prone to get worn out over time. They're not able to press against the receiver module, which causes it to not respond to key commands. Luckily, this is a simple fix that can be solved by using new buttons and reprogramed by an agent.

To change the battery on a Bentley keyfob, you will have to remove the case. There is a small screw located at the top of the compartment for the battery and you need to remove this. You must open the door with care to reveal the printed-circuit board. You'll need to take extra care as the metal clip which holds the batteries wants to fall.

Poor Battery Contact

Metal clips are used to hold the battery in the Bentley key fob. When these lose tension or get corroded they can prevent the battery from making contact with the chip that sends electrical current to the remote control. A damaged connection could cause a remote to cease to function.

If your Bentley key fob isn't functioning, you may have to get it fixed or replaced. It can stop working for several reasons, such as a dead remote control chip or a dead coin-cell battery. A faulty battery can also stop the key fob pairing with the vehicle.

The first step in identifying an issue with a key is to determine whether the button cell battery is depleted. If it is, replace it with a new battery of identical in size and voltage. After this, you can test the fob by pressing its buttons. If the key fob does not work, it could be due to other issues such as water damage.
